    67 changes: 67 additions & 0 deletions simple_websocket_client.html
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,67 @@
    <!DOCTYPE html>
    <html lang="en">
    <head>
    <title>WebSocket Client</title>
    <style>
    #output {
    border: solid 1px #000;
    }
    </style>
    </head>
    <body>

    <form id="form">
    <input type="text" id="message">
    <button type="submit">Send</button>
    </form>

    <hr>

    <div id="output"></div>

    <script>

    var inputBox = document.getElementById("message");
    var output = document.getElementById("output");
    var form = document.getElementById("form");

    try {

    var host = "ws://" + window.location.hostname + ":9876/stuff";
    console.log("Host:", host);

    var s = new WebSocket(host);

    s.onopen = function (e) {
    console.log("Socket opened.");
    };

    s.onclose = function (e) {
    console.log("Socket closed.");
    };

    s.onmessage = function (e) {
    console.log("Socket message:", e.data);
    var p = document.createElement("p");
    p.innerHTML = e.data;
    output.appendChild(p);
    };

    s.onerror = function (e) {
    console.log("Socket error:", e);
    };

    } catch (ex) {
    console.log("Socket exception:", ex);
    }

    form.addEventListener("submit", function (e) {
    e.preventDefault();
    s.send(inputBox.value);
    inputBox.value = "";
    }, false)

    </script>

    </body>
    </html>
    89 changes: 89 additions & 0 deletions simple_websocket_server.py
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,89 @@
    #!/usr/bin/env python

    import socket, struct, hashlib, threading, cgi

    def decode_key (key):
    num = ""
    spaces = 0
    for c in key:
    if c.isdigit():
    num += c
    if c.isspace():
    spaces += 1
    return int(num) / spaces

    def create_hash (key1, key2, code):
    a = struct.pack(">L", decode_key(key1))
    b = struct.pack(">L", decode_key(key2))
    md5 = hashlib.md5(a + b + code)
    return md5.digest()

    def recv_data (client, length):
    data = client.recv(length)
    if not data: return data
    return data.decode('utf-8', 'ignore')

    def send_data (client, data):
    message = "\x00%s\xFF" % data.encode('utf-8')
    return client.send(message)

    def parse_headers (data):
    headers = {}
    lines = data.splitlines()
    for l in lines:
    parts = l.split(": ", 1)
    if len(parts) == 2:
    headers[parts[0]] = parts[1]
    headers['code'] = lines[len(lines) - 1]
    return headers

    def handshake (client):
    print 'Handshaking...'
    data = client.recv(1024)
    headers = parse_headers(data)
    print 'Got headers:'
    for k, v in headers.iteritems():
    print k, ':', v
    digest = create_hash(
    headers['Sec-WebSocket-Key1'],
    headers['Sec-WebSocket-Key2'],
    headers['code']
    )
    shake = "HTTP/1.1 101 Web Socket Protocol Handshake\r\n"
    shake += "Upgrade: WebSocket\r\n"
    shake += "Connection: Upgrade\r\n"
    shake += "Sec-WebSocket-Origin: %s\r\n" % (headers['Origin'])
    shake += "Sec-WebSocket-Location: ws://%s/stuff\r\n" % (headers['Host'])
    shake += "Sec-WebSocket-Protocol: sample\r\n\r\n"
    shake += digest
    return client.send(shake)

    def handle (client, addr):
    handshake(client)
    lock = threading.Lock()
    while 1:
    data = recv_data(client, 1024)
    if not data: break
    data = cgi.escape(data)
    lock.acquire()
    [send_data(c, data) for c in clients]
    lock.release()
    print 'Client closed:', addr
    lock.acquire()
    clients.remove(client)
    lock.release()
    client.close()

    def start_server ():
    s = socket.socket()
    s.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1)
    s.bind(('', 9876))
    s.listen(5)
    while 1:
    conn, addr = s.accept()
    print 'Connection from:', addr
    clients.append(conn)
    threading.Thread(target = handle, args = (conn, addr)).start()

    clients = []
    start_server()
